I am in a heated back and forth with the CEO of Escort as well as the head of customer service. I contend that the latest firmware upgrade (The August 2018 firmware update) did not remedy the freezing / lockup issue that was introduced with a prior firmware update. Apparently I am the only one that is having this issue as not a single user has reported this issue post 8/18 firmware update (according to Escort).
If that is the case so be it but if not can you reply to this thread so I can point Gail (ceo) and Shawn (CS head) to this thread. I feel like my concerns have fallen on deaf ears and there is no intent to remedy this issue for any impacted users

Update: 12/12/18**************************************************************************************************
Sadly there has not been or do I anticipate a formal response moving forward from Escort. Despite me providing significant data points that clearly contracdict what Escort has shared with me in writing (i have the emails fromn Gail (CEO) and Shawn (head of customer service) where they clearly state that there is not a problem, they are not seeing this problem and not a single user has brought this to their attention post 8/18 firmware update. Let me recap specifically what has been shared:
“Escort,” to me via email:
1. Good news, based on the customer feedback previously received our engineers had modified the software on the Max 360 to resolve the “freezing” issue. This software update was done in August of 2018.
2. While we appreciate your feedback, truly, we just aren’t seeing the same information you are. I have scoured several forums & Youtube and cannot find reports or videos of the issue post firmware update.
3. In addition, we have a team of testers (enthusiasts) in the field who help us to identify and resolve bugs, and none of them is seeing it, either.
4. “I also know that Vortex is still actively promoting the 360 and 360c as 2 of the best detectors on the market, and I can’t imagine he would do that if he knew of a widespread unaddressed problem
When presented with this thread and other threads that clearly claim that the firmware did not remedy the issue Escort has refused to engage and states that “we can not claim an issue that we know not to exist. (I have this in writing.)
What I find truly odd is that others have shared on this thread that they spoke to Escort and they agreed that this issue is a priority to resolve. Why would they acknowledge the issue privately with some but when confronted by their other users they continue to deny or won’t engage. Perplexing.
So there you have it. I feel there will need to be more folks presenting this issue to Escort directly to the point they won’t have any other option to acknowledge the problem and address the issue with a remedy accordingly. But for now new users prior to their purchase really should read this thread and other like threads so they can make a fully informed purschase. Because even if there is a 1% chance the 360 or 360c could become frozen / lockup and not work as advertised than that is a risk that needs to be disclosed to any potential buyer so they can make an informed decision regarding their purchase or not based on all the info.
